For optimal sun protection , it is important to apply Avène sunscreen evenly and in sufficient quantity. It is recommended to apply a generous amount of product (about a teaspoon for the face and an equivalent amount for each limb of the body) at least 15 minutes before sun exposure. It is also important to reapply the product every two hours and after swimming or sweating.
The SPF, or sun protection factor, indicates the amount of protection offered by a sunscreen product. Avène sun care products are available in a range of SPFs, ranging from 30 to 50+ . The SPF you need will depend on your skin type and how long you've been exposed to the sun. People with fair and sensitive skin will need a higher SPF than people with dark or tanned skin.

Following the publication of several articles about a request that ANSES would have sent to the government for a restriction of the octocrylene sunscreen , it is important to remember that Klorane , Avène and ADerma sunscreens do not contain of octocrylene.
Eau Thermale Avène, right from its first Ecran Total sunscreen in 1987, has never ceased to advance photoprotection with increasing respect for the environment.
In 2010, the brand took the gamble of launching a research program aimed at removing octocrylene from its sunscreen formulas. In 2013, this program made it possible to replace octocrylene with a combination of 4 sun filters* providing equivalent photoprotection for optimal biodegradability and reduced impact on the marine environment.
And to go even further, Pierre Fabre launched, 2 years ago, its own solar filter, TRIASORB™, the 1st organic filter with the unique feature of absorbing and reflecting the harmful part of the solar spectrum , which includes UVB, short UVA, long UVA but also visible high energy blue light.
TRIASORB™, manufactured in the Pierre Fabre factory located in Gaillac in the Tarn, has also passed numerous tests under experimental conditions to prove its lack of toxicity on 3 key species of marine biodiversity: a species of coral, a species of phytoplankton and one species of zooplankton.
*Tinosorb S, Tinosorb M, Uvasorb HEB, Parsol 1789
